Gymnastics Career Highlights

2008 Olympic Success and Key Events

At the 2008 Beijing Olympics, Shawn Johnson earned one gold and two silver medals. Her performances on balance beam and floor exercise were central to her medal haul, highlighting the blend of strength, precision, and artistry required at the highest level of gymnastics. These results established her as one of the top gymnasts of her generation and contributed to ongoing public curiosity about her training, physique, and weight management strategies.

Understanding Weight in Elite Gymnastics

Why Weight and Body Composition Matter

In artistic gymnastics, weight and body composition influence performance variables such as power-to-weight ratio, balance, and joint stress. Lower body weight can aid execution on apparatus like balance beam and rings, while sufficient strength is necessary to perform complex skills safely. As a result, many elite gymnasts, including Shawn Johnson, have historically maintained lean physiques, with weight carefully managed relative to training load and nutritional needs. Public interest in her weight reflects these performance considerations.

General Ranges and Individual Variation

Gymnastics does not have a standardized weight category, so athletes operate across a range of body masses optimized for their specific events and body types. Reported weights among elite female gymnasts often fall between approximately 82 and 112 pounds (roughly 37 to 51 kilograms), though individual figures vary based on height, frame, and training phase. Shawn Johnson’s reported weight during her competitive years typically aligned with this spectrum, though precise, verified measurements are rarely documented in official sources.
